For medical billing and reimbursement, this package follows the 11-digit CMS format: 59579000407. The table below illustrates the segment conversion from the 10-digit labeler code to the 11-digit provider format.

11-Digit Code Conversion

Billing payers usually require a 5-4-2 segment configuration. Below is the conversion from the 10-digit package format to the 11-digit billing format:

10-Digit Format (5-3-2)
59579-004-07
11-Digit CMS (5-4-2)
59579-0004-07

Note: The zero is added to the Product segment to maintain the 5-4-2 structure.
